How is this the first time I’m hearing about Extra Crispy?!  It’s the perfect mix of salty and sweet, except in article and recipe form.  When invited to share the new cookbook Breakfast with you, I had to check it out.

This is a lovely large hardcover with the most wonderful photos of breakfast foods.    You can learn how to make a copycat Taco Bell breakfast wrap, sausage and cheese bread, or a terrific squash and spam hash.   It’s more than just the how-to-cook type of recipe.  Step by step instructions are included to make this ideal for those who need true cooking instruction.  This would be a wonderful gift for anyone who has an inclination to enjoy a yummy meal.  A college student, a newlywed, or a 40ish woman like me — these  recipes are for everyone who loves delicious food.

Even if you’re not inclined to get up and prepare one of the recipes, you can visually enjoy these wordy delectables.  The articles are funny, unique, and highly entertaining.   Granted, they’re probably taken straight from the website, but I love having them in print form.  This is the type of book you can take with you on a camping weekend or a beach trip; it doubles as inspiration and entertainment.

ABOUT EXTRA CRISPY

Extra Crispy is the authority on breakfast and brunch, but it’s so much more than recipes. Extra Crispy will teach you how to poach an egg, followed by a discussion on how to feel about poaching eggs. The website covers the history of food, foodways around the world, and the chefs inspiring and changing the food industry, along with cooking tips and videos. Extra Crispy’s stories are personal, opinionated, and sometimes on the fringes of the food media landscape. The site showcases celebrity chefs and emerging voices from around the world, and behind it all is a sincere celebration of breakfast food and the culture surrounding it. Extra Crispy is a Meredith Corporation brand.
